AMD HAS LET THE CAT out of the bag on a new version of its Athlon processor. DigiTimes has learned that the company has informed chipset designers and motherboard makers that a version of Barton with a 400MHz front side bus (FS will become available in May.
The only difference between the current Barton and the newer processor will be the FSB speed. However, that could be enough to cause a reasonable jump in both performance and PR rating. Based on previous increases in FSB speeds, there should be at least a 5% improvement in performance, probably turning a 2.17GHz 3000+ Barton into a 2.2GHz 3200+.

Chipset makers and motherboard manufacturers have indicated that they will support the new chip. The timing could be better for some of them, AMD has only just introduced the Barton with a 333MHz FSB and Via's latest KT400a only supports that speed. Perhaps there will be a KT400B?
